Question:60 The nurse includes the important measures for stump care in the teaching plan for a client with an amputation. Which measure would be excluded from the teaching plan? A. Wash, dry, and inspect the stump daily B. Treat superficial abrasions and blisters promptly C. Apply a “shrinker” bandage with tighter arms around the proximal end of the affected limb D. Toughen the stump by pushing it against a progressively harder substance (e.g., pillow on a foot-stool) Answer:C Apply a "shrinker" bandage with tighter arms around the proximal end of the affected limb. The “shrinker” bandage is applied to prevent swelling of the stump. It should be applied at the distal end with the tighter arms. Applying the tighter arms at the proximal end will impair circulation and cause swelling by reducing venous flow.
